> David is right.  In particular, the number of rows
> is ALWAYS the maximum number of rows you EVER want
> to display on screen.  When you wish to have more
> rows than fit onto the screen, you actually scroll
> the data through your rows (not the rows through the
> screen) -- i.e., now your row #1 points to the
> second data item, etc.

> 1) it sounds like you should probably give the table
> the maximum number of
> rows that will ever show on the screen, and set them
> to not usable at run
> time if you don't need them
> 
> 2) and 3) If the text isn't editable, I think you
> would be better off just
> using a customTableItem for the text cells.  Then
> you can draw whatever you
> want in each cell dynamically in the callback
> routine that you specify with
> TblSetCustomDrawProcedure().
